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$236.75 | 13.511% | $268.7373 | $268.74 | $268.75 | $268.70 |
Purchase #2 | $176.68 | 13.531% | $200.5866 | $200.59 | $200.60 | $200.60 |
Purchase #3 | $107.74 | 6.224% | $114.4457 | $114.45 | $114.45 | $114.40 |
Purchase #4 | $157.63 | 7.856% | $170.0134 | $170.01 | $170.00 | $170.00 |
Purchase #5 | $138.82 | 3.459% | $143.6218 | $143.62 | $143.60 | $143.60 |
Purchase #6 | $203.97 | 8.233% | $220.7629 | $220.76 | $220.75 | $220.80 |
Purchase #7 | $142.76 | 7.796% | $153.8896 | $153.89 | $153.90 | $153.90 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,164.35 | $1,272.0573 | $1,272.06 | $1,272.05 | $1,272.00 |
